I have created a piechart and an areachart, both representing the number of
tickets sold per type, with the piechart focusing on the total number of
tickets sold and the areachart the timeline they were sold. I now want to
make sure the color assigned to each ticket type is replicated across both
charts. Initially I thought of simply sorting the data based on number of
tickets sold and assigning colors based on order, but the data structure
for the areachart and the piechart is slightly different and the areachart
only includes total tickets sold per day vs all time. My plan was to assign
colors based on the number of total tickets sold in the piechart and the
mimic that in the timeline by assigning colors based on matching ticket
type names. I tried doing this by adding an extra column to the chart with
the 'style' property, storing the color data there but it doesn't seem to
work. Any advice? This is my code sofar:
